How to break friendship with Am Fah/Jade Brotherhood?
I really need to break up with Am Fah so I can get Quivering Blade skill from that Am Fah boss. I have sonewhy drunk from the cauldron of corruption or whatever it is, and now I could do the 'Masters of Corruption' quest. As I understand it, completing 'Masters of Corruption' will make the Am Fah hostile once more:
quote from the Guildwiki article: "Brother Tosai will beg for his life, bargaining for mercy with the removal of the chalice's degen effect. Once removed, the quest is complete. From then, all Am Fah will revert to being hostile." |

For future reference:
You can cap the skill before making the Am Fah your friend. You can unlock the skill on another character or through Blathazar Faction and then use an Elite Warrior Tome. I did the latter on my title hunting character as I prefer having the Am Fah as my friend. Makes running around in those areas much less of a hassle. |
